掌握MATLAB实战项目:eig函数源码下载与分析

版权申诉
0 下载量 48 浏览量 更新于2024-11-13 收藏 10KB RAR 举报
资源摘要信息:"ivtv-streams,matlab中eig源码,matlab源码下载" 1. ivtv-streams ivtv-streams项目涉及到Linux系统下的视频捕获设备驱动模块开发。ivtv是针对Philips的Conexant CX2388x系列视频解码器芯片(比如在许多PCTV卡中使用)的开源驱动模块。ivtv模块是Linux内核中的一个模块,它允许用户空间程序通过Video4Linux (V4L2) 接口与视频捕获设备交互。项目中包含的ivtv-streams.c和ivtv-streams.h文件,可能分别提供了实现特定功能的源代码和头文件。ivtv-streams.c可能包含了驱动的主体代码,负责与硬件交互、数据流控制等核心功能,而ivtv-streams.h则定义了相关的宏、函数声明以及数据结构等,为用户程序提供接口。 2. matlab中eig源码 在MATLAB中,eig函数用于计算矩阵的特征值和特征向量。它是线性代数中非常基础且重要的操作之一。MATLAB作为数学计算和工程领域广泛使用的软件,其内部函数的源码通常是由MATLAB语言或更底层的C/C++代码编写而成。通过研究这些源码,可以帮助开发者深入理解算法的实现原理,进而优化算法性能或自定义特定功能。源码下载对于学习和教学实践具有较高价值,尤其适合对算法原理感兴趣的编程人员和研究者。 3. matlab源码下载 在学术界和工程实践中,获取MATLAB源码对于深入学习算法原理、进行二次开发以及理解软件的内部工作机制都十分有益。下载源码后,用户可以详细查看算法的具体实现方式,理解函数的内部逻辑,甚至可以在此基础上进行功能改进或缺陷修正。此外,如果是在教学中,教师可能希望学生通过阅读源码来更好地掌握理论知识,并将其与实际应用相结合。因此,提供MATLAB源码下载的服务满足了广泛的学习和研究需求。 4. AVerMedia M179 GPIO info by Chris Pinkham AVerMedia M179是一款电视棒设备,它具有许多编程接口,允许开发者通过编程对其进行控制。Chris Pinkham提供的GPIO信息可能详细描述了如何通过编程方式访问和控制该设备的通用输入输出端口(GPIO)。GPIO端口是硬件设备上用于输入或输出信号的接口,通过这些端口可以控制硬件上的LED灯、按钮、传感器等多种外设。获取这些信息对硬件开发者来说非常有用,因为它们可以利用这些接口开发新的功能,或者为现有硬件编写定制化的控制程序。 综上所述,本资源提供了一个深入了解视频捕获设备驱动开发、MATLAB算法实现、以及电视棒硬件控制的契机。通过研究ivtv-streams源码,学习者能够掌握如何开发Linux下的视频设备驱动;通过MATLAB源码的下载与学习,可以提高对重要数学算法的理解和应用能力;而对AVerMedia M179的GPIO信息的了解,则可以增强对硬件控制编程的认识。对于IT行业和学术研究来说,这些知识都是非常实用且重要的。